Moog steering and suspension line grows

Feb. 11, 2014

Federal-Mogul Corp. has added nearly 70 parts to its Moog steering and suspension product line.

The expansion includes more than 50 parts for late-model foreign- nameplate passenger vehicles from BMW, Honda, Mazda, Mercedes-Benz, Subaru, Toyota and other manufacturers.

“We continue to aggressively expand our foreign-nameplate coverage to help vehicle service providers increase their share of this growing category,” says Mark Boyle, director, steering and suspension products, North America, Federal-Mogul vehicle components segment.

The new parts include:

* 12 Moog R-series replacement control arms and assemblies;

* 32 stabilizer bar bushing kits;

* several stabilizer bar link kits; and

* a variety of tie rod ends, ball joints, coil spring sets and other premium-quality components.

Federal-Mogul also continues to expand its line of Moog complete strut assemblies, with two new assemblies now available for 1996-2002 Toyota 4Runner trucks.
